i have a div profile, what up until a few days ago has been fine, it is still fine in mozilla firefox, but most of it is missing in ie, i wondered if anyone else has had this problem and might know a way to fix it, here is my myspace url, http:\\www.myspace.com/m1ch4el1988
help would be much appreciated! |

Things you can try :
- Giving your divs a different z-index. - Are you positive it was working in IE before? If not you can try different codes to see how its going. - Make sure its ALL versions of IE and not just one. (Ask your friends to look at your page) - If you are using margins for positioning make sure you being consistent. - When using margins you can also try doing this: left: 50%; margin left: #px; top: 0%; margin-top: #px; ( Someone previously told me that fixed their problem. Don't know how but yea) - How much of your profile is not showing? If its just an area then try using replacement codes for that div or space. |
